About The Position

The Manager, Information Management supports the delivery of Healthfirst’s data platforms and solutions by leading day-to-day execution for a defined set of data products, pipelines, or platform capabilities. This role partners with product owners, architects, governance, and business stakeholders to translate requirements into high-quality, secure, and scalable data assets that enable analytics, regulatory reporting, and business operations. The Manager leads an Agile delivery team (analysts, developers, testers, and/or scrum master support), ensuring reliable delivery, strong operational discipline, and continuous improvement across planning, build, testing, release, and production support.
